To adjust the clutch on a Massey Ferguson tractor, first, ensure the tractor is on a level surface and the engine is off. Locate the clutch adjustment mechanism, usually found near the clutch pedal. Loosen the lock nut and turn the adjusting screw until there is a slight play in the pedal (typically around 1-2 inches), then re-tighten the lock nut. Finally, test the clutch engagement to ensure proper function.

How do you adjust clutch on mf 135 tractor?

To adjust the clutch on a Massey Ferguson 135 tractor, first, ensure the tractor is in neutral and the engine is off. Locate the clutch adjustment rod, which is typically found on the left side of the tractor, and loosen the lock nut. Adjust the rod to achieve about 1-1.5 inches of free play at the top of the clutch pedal before tightening the lock nut again. Always check the adjustment by pressing the pedal to ensure smooth operation and proper disengagement of the clutch.


What type oil is used in massey ferguson 1428 rear end?

Use Massey Ferguson hydraulic oil or an equivalent due to the unit having a wet brakes and clutch, regular hydraulic oil will give you problems down the road.
